Wnt/β-catenin agonist 3 (compound 98) is a Wnt/β-catenin signalling pathway agonist. Wnt/β-catenin agonist 3 can be used for the research of osteoporosis[1].
Wnt/β-catenin agonist 3 (compound 98; 24 h; HEK293 and SW480 cells) has 54% cell activity at 120 μM concentration compared with the positive control group LiCl (20mM)[1].
Wnt/β-catenin agonist 3 (30 and 60 μM; 24 h; HEK293 cells) is an activator for β-Catenin and deposits β-catenin[1].
Wnt/β-catenin agonist 3 (11 μM; 4 d) induces differentiation of ST2 cell line into osteoblasts and calcium deposition[1].
